Originally Posted by hawtheric1
please remind me why i don't want a black car. pics are encouraged.
- next to impossible to keep it clean. drive a few miles down the road after washing the car, and you'll see dust on the body.
- hides the body curves & lines, hides the material differences like the hood and air dam grilles.
